## Local Setup: Timezone Handling

The Quillmere export service stores every timestamp in UTC and applies the requesting tenant's timezone only at serialization. For local development, set `EXPORT_TZ_SOURCE=tenant` so your output matches production behavior; leaving it unset defaults to the host timezone, which has caused subtle off-by-one-day bugs in daily report boundaries. Seed the tenant timezone table with `make seed-tz` before running any export. Point your local service at the development database using the connection string below.

primary connection of yagep-kahip = redis://giliel_svc:zYiKsLL2PLpfPL@db-348f.xolmarsys.corp:5432/fenwyn

Ticket VD-318: Configuration drift in validator plugin registry. The staging instance of Fieldgate loads third-party validator plugins from a manifest that no longer matches what production serves. Two plugins (schema-check and range-guard) run with relaxed settings in staging, which undermines the security review of the plugin sandbox. Before approving the sandbox changes, please compare against the authoritative values. The current production configuration for the plugin loader is as follows.

config for taguf-tagaf:
[istix]
port = 9300
team = aldix
host = istix.qorvelsoft.example
region = upper-2
access_code = ac_bda5cc
timeout_ms = 5000

# Fabrikit env file — release manager notes
# Fabrikit is the test-data factory library used by the Quillware suite.
# These values control seed behavior, fixture caching, and the remote
# fixture registry. Defaults below are safe for release builds; only the
# registry settings change per environment. The registry rejects anonymous
# pushes, so the publish credential must be set. That line goes here:

vault entry, kagep-yajeg: COURIER_KEY5=da097

Handover note — Crumbwheel order cutoffs.

Welcome aboard. The bakery cutoff rule in Crumbwheel closes same-day orders at 14:00 local to each storefront, not UTC — this has bitten us twice. Holiday overrides live in the calendar service and take precedence silently, so always check there first when a cutoff looks wrong. To unlock the calendar service's admin console after a restart, enter the recovery passphrase below.

vault phrase of bagap-bahaf = silion-pelox-sorox-casdor-quenwyn-fraax-eliox-praael-kelion-quenvan-kasox-rusael-norius-belvan